你查询的IP:[61.48.17.59]  地理位置:中国–北京–北京

最新查询58.66.65.80 222.168.5.5 117.8.87.65 59.64.30.52 124.64.251.94 59.107.72.2 117.8.60.77 119.3.33.41 120.92.8.76 61.48.17.59 221.224.130.246 203.92.160.78 119.75.208.48 116.208.170.148 210.15.128.238 203.128.96.203 124.192.18.160 202.189.80.160 60.55.221.93 203.191.64.33 203.99.16.133 59.108.182.121 202.122.214.242 119.60.158.50 123.206.61.25 202.127.16.3 202.14.88.99 169.211.1.122 119.27.192.161 119.27.160.164 123.232.61.173